Final Orders / Judgements
The Judicial Magistrate First Class, Hingna, convicted Prashant Prakashrao Dabekar under Section 21 of the COTPA Act, 2003 after he voluntarily pleaded guilty to the offense. The court sentenced him to pay a fine of Rs. 200, with two days simple imprisonment as default punishment if the fine remains unpaid.
